Understanding Niche Content Marketing
Niche content marketing refers to the approach of creating content tailored specifically for a particular audience segment or market niche. This strategy is especially advantageous for startups, as it enables them to stand out in crowded markets and cultivate a loyal customer base.
The key to successful niche content marketing lies in identifying and understanding your target audience. By focusing on a specific area, startups can better fulfill the unique needs and interests of their customers, leading to higher engagement and conversion rates.
The Importance of Defining Your Niche
Before diving into content creation, startups must clearly define their niche. Determining what sets your product, service, or brand apart is crucial. Here are some steps to help delineate your niche:
- Market Research: Analyze existing competitors and identify gaps in the market. What are they not addressing that your audience desires?
- Target Audience: Develop detailed buyer personas that represent the various segments within your target market. What are their pain points, interests, and preferences?
- Unique Value Proposition: Clearly articulate how your offerings differ from competitors and why potential customers should choose you. What unique benefits do you provide?
A well-defined niche aids in crafting relevant, high-quality content that resonates with your desired audience.
Developing Niche Content Marketing Strategies for Startups
With your niche established, the next step is to implement targeted content marketing strategies. Here are some effective approaches:
1. Produce High-Quality Content
Creating high-quality content that addresses the specific needs of your niche is paramount. This content can take various forms, such as:
- Blog Posts: Write informative articles that engage your audience, answer their questions, and provide valuable insights.
- Videos: Utilize video content to visually explain complex topics or showcase your products effectively.
- Podcasts: Share industry-related content through podcasts to build authority and connect with your audience on a personal level.

2. Leverage Social Media Channels
Identify which social media platforms your target audience frequents and tailor your content accordingly. Each platform has a distinct user base and communication style. Here’s how to optimize your social media strategy:
- Content Variety: Share different types of content, such as articles, images, infographics, and live videos.
- Engagement: Actively engage with followers through comments, polls, and direct messages to foster community and transparency.
- Influencer Collaborations: Partner with niche influencers to tap into their dedicated audience and bolster credibility.
3. Use Data Analytics for Improvement
Understanding customer behavior is critical for refining your marketing strategies. Collect and analyze data to gain insights into how your audience interacts with your content. Here are ways to utilize data analytics effectively:
- Traffic Analysis: Monitor website analytics to evaluate which content performs best and refine your strategy accordingly.
- Feedback Collection: Use surveys or polls to gather customer feedback on your content and offerings.
- Conversion Tracking: Assess which types of content lead to the highest conversion rates and adjust your focus as necessary.

4. Implement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
SEO is pivotal in enhancing the visibility of your content within search engines. Targeting niche keywords can help you attract the right audience segments. Consider these strategies:
- Keyword Research: Use tools to discover high-volume, low-competition keywords relevant to your niche.
- On-Page SEO: Optimize your content structure, including headers, meta descriptions, and alt texts, to improve search rankings.
- Backlinking: Collaborate with other niche websites to generate backlinks, enhancing your site's authority and ranking.
Measuring Success: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
Once your niche content marketing strategies are in place, tracking your performance is vital to gauge success. Key performance indicators (KPIs) to monitor include:
- Website Traffic: Analyze the number of visitors to gauge interest in your content.
- Engagement Rates: Evaluate likes, shares, comments, and time spent on page to measure audience engagement.
- Conversion Rates: Monitor how often visitors take desired actions, such as signing up for newsletters or making purchases.
Regular assessment allows startups to pivot strategies continuously, ensuring continued alignment with market demands.
